Оболочка GNOME не обнаруживает пользовательский .desktop файл

Согласно официальному руководству, средство запуска гнома поддерживает, чтобы видеть и отобразиться пользовательский .desktop файл в этих двух путях:
/usr/share/applications
~/.local/share/applications

Но никакой путь выше работ. Я даже перезапускаю ОС, но ничто не изменяется. Я также пытаюсь locate некоторый образец .desktop в средстве запуска гнома включая встроенные приложения и новые приложения (openToonz). Вот путь, который я нашел:
/var/lib/snapd/desktop/applications

По-видимому, я копирую мой .desktop к пути выше и ожидающий... в пустоте.

Что я делал неправильно? Ниже содержание в моем .desktop

[Desktop Entry]
Name=OALD
Comment=Open OALD online in Firefox
Exec=firefox "https://www.oxfordlearnersdictionaries.com"
Icon=oald.png
Type=Application
NoDisplay=true
StartupNotify=true
Categories=Education; Network; Dictionary;
Keywords=dictionary;internet;web app;
Actions=private-mode


[Desktop Action private-mode]
Name=Open in Private Mode
Exec=firefox -private-window "https://www.oxfordlearnersdictionaries.com"

Btw, мой .desktop ссылка, открытая Firefox.

1
задан 6 February 2019 в 23:36

1 ответ

Единственная вещь неправильно с Вашим .desktop файл является следующей строкой:

NoDisplay=true

NoDisplay=true средства

это приложение существует, но не отображайте его в меню.

Так или удалить эту строку или изменяют его на

NoDisplay=false

Затем поместите .desktop файл в ~/.local/share/applications (только для текущего пользователя) или в /usr/share/applications (для всех пользователей).

0
ответ дан 7 December 2019 в 21:26

Другие вопросы по тегам:

Похожие вопросы: